ASP.NET应用程序从webforms转移到路由,重定向url的最佳方式



我正在更新我们的web应用程序,使用路由而不是webform页面名称。处理将所有旧地址重定向到新地址的最佳方法是什么?

我最关心的是网络蜘蛛等。当某个页面被请求返回302标头并重定向时,是否有可能?

是否有一个简单的方法来管理这一切从一个位置?

如果是我,我会创建一个IIS重定向到一个ASPX重定向。这意味着我会将所有旧地址重定向到特定的页面,然后该页面将读取原始地址头,并基于其中一个,创建具有适当参数的Routing调用,这将自然而然地将用户重定向到适当的页面。

最新更新